Quote:
Originally Posted by FishyKat View Post
A year later and my bryposis is back. I ordered more fluconazole to battle them again


I had the same thing happen to me. This time I used half the recommended dosage and only removed my carbon. It worked just as quickly.
If it comes back again, I will try only using one capsule to see what happens.
It will come back, it’s impossible to stop spores from entering from new livestock.
